B-Roll 025: Hook, Line and Murder

Matt outdoes himself this week with his film idea. A horror police procedural following the Maritime Murderer. Fishermen are dying left, right and center and it’s up to Derek Bowie, the Captain of the Coast Guard Homicide department to put a stop to this maritime menace. It’s what the press are calling “The Zodiac killer of the sea”, complete with cryptic messages written using pieces of flesh attached to hooks. Things get personal and maybe Derek shouldn’t trust the people around him. Everyone’s a suspect but maybe Derek can use his seatime detective skills and put a stop to the killer. It’s “Hook, Line and Murder”.

There’s also a lot of discussion about the pronunciation of the word ‘buoy’ so prepare yourselves for that.
